About CGPDTM :ย ย 

The Office of the Controller General of Patents, Designs & Trade Marks (CGPDTM) is located at Mumbai. The Head Office of the Patent office is at Kolkata and its Branch offices are located at Chennai, New Delhi and Mumbai. The Trade Marks registry is at Mumbai and its Branches are located in Kolkata, Chennai, Ahmedabad and New Delhi. The Design Office is located at Kolkata in the Patent Office. The Offices of The Patent Information System (PIS) and National Institute of Intellectual Property Management (NIIPM) are at Nagpur. In order to protect the Geographical Indications of goods a Geographical Indications Registry has been established in Chennai to administer the Geographical Indications of Goods (Registration and Protection) Act, 1999 under the CGPDTM.

Selection Process:

  • The selection process includes an Examination/Interview.
  • The Examination will consist of three phases as follows
  • Preliminary Examination for screening of candidates for the main examination
  • Mains Examination for shortlisting of candidates for Interviews and
  • Interview.
  • The medium of examination for preliminary and mains examinations as well as interviews shall be English only.

Preliminary Examination:

  • This examination is meant to serve as a screening test and the marks secured in this examination will not be considered in the declaration of the final list of qualified candidates.
  • This examination will be conducted in ONLINE mode only.
  • It will consist of one paper of objective-type multiple-choice questions and will comprise of 150 marks .
  • This examination will be of a duration of 2 hours.
  • A maximum of 150 questions, each question carrying one mark, will be present in this paper, which will consist of multiple-choice questions to test General English (15 marks), Verbal and Non-Verbal Reasoning (30 marks), Quantitative Aptitude (30 marks), General Knowledge and Current Affairs (30 marks), General Science (30 marks) and IP legislation in India, WIPO and related treaties (15 marks).

Mains Examination:

  • The mains examination will be conducted in offline mode only and will consist of a written examination, which will consist of 2 papers i.e. Paper โ€“I (OMR Based) and Paper โ€“II (Descriptive answer).
  • Paper I will be of 100 marks and Paper โ€“II will be of 300 marks.
  • Paper-I will be of 2 hours duration and will comprise a maximum of 100 objective type multiple-choice questions, each question carrying one mark, to test the General Knowledge and Current Affairs (20 Marks), General Aptitude (20 Marks), Elementary mathematics (20 Marks), English language proficiency (20 Marks) and knowledge related to intellectual property rights (IPRs) (20 Marks).
  • Paper-II will test the knowledge of the candidate in the technical/scientific discipline of the vacancy applied for Paper-II will be of 3 hours duration and will comprise 300 marks having descriptive questions.
  • The cumulative marks obtained in Paper-I and Paper-II will be assigned 80% weightage in the final list of qualified candidates.

Interview:

  • The interview will be of 100 marks and will test the candidate on the topics covered in the preliminary and main examinations.
  • The marks obtained in the interview will be given 20% weightage in the final list of qualified candidates.
